The Lord is our CEO

 

Treeferns Trout Lodge is totally committed to the Christian way of doing business.

The good Lord has been blessing us abundantly over the years  we have been operating at Treeferns. He provides in our needs, and protects us from evil in ways that takes one’s breath away. Praise the Lord !  We do have our problems, but He is always with us, and carries us through.

We have a step brother, and brother-in-law, Frederik Maré, living on the farm, which would have been his inheritance. But he could not have it because of a handicap. He suffered brain damage at birth with the sad consequence that he never learned to speak, read, and write. However, he can hear and understand, and he is as strong as  an ox. Of course his  mother, long deceased now, was extremely worried about what would one day after her death, become of him.

In 1994 my wife and I got involved on the farm, and when mother-in-law died in 1998 we took over and since then cared for Frederik.  I strongly believe the Lord rewards us beyond our wildest dreams true to His promise: “ And He will answer, ‘ I tell you the truth, when you refuse to help the least of my brothers and sisters, you were refusing to help me’ “ (Matthews 25 ; 45) (New Living Translation, 1996). ” En Hy sal antwoord, ‘Vir sover julle dit aan een van hierdie geringstes nie gedoen het nie, het julle dit aan my ook nie gedoen nie’ ” ( 1983 vertaling).

Our plans for the farm came off and  business grew steadily motivating us  to gradually expand.  Throughout we prayed  the Lord to use us and the farm alike for His Kingdom.  Initially He  did not seem to have heard us, but slowly followers of Jesus, individuals and small groups started visiting. Right now we are frequented by many small and bigger church groups, schools, welfare organisations, and of course individuals and families committed to the Lord.

Also on one of my regular visits to the farm ( we live in Centurion) I met Frans Opperman, a follower of Jesus if ever there was one. After the usual trivialities, I learned that Frans worked for a company Big C Rock Engineering, operating in rock mechanics for the mining industry. One of the Company’s objectives is to spend 10% of nett income for Bible distribution through an affiliate company, Mission Rock.( http://www.missionrock.co.za ) How meritorious ! Asked for a few Bibles for the chalets, Frans brought us 200 Bibles of different languages, and since then many more. We place them with our visitors, schools, churches, anyone in need of a Bible.

We can carry on like this for much longer, but suffice to say the Lord is ruling Treeferns Trout Lodge; He is our CEO par excellence.

Diabetes South Africa’s flyfishing competition

 

On 29 October 2011 a memorable and successful fly fishing competition was hosted in aid of Diabetes South Africa by The Village Angler, Greystone Lodge, and Treeferns Trout Lodge. A total amount of R10 000 was collected. Prices to the value of R30 000 were sponsored, and all of the 21 participants won at least one price if only a goodie bag.  The grand winners were :

Nesher Privaatskool

Nesher Privaatskool by Delmas het ons op 12 – 14 Oktober 2011 besoek.

Nesher is Hebreeus vir Arend of die plek waar mense arendsvlerke kry.

Nesher Privaatskool het in Januarie 2001 die eerste lewenslig gesien toe Jaco en Stella Haasbroek die tuisskool van hulle kinders omskep het in ‘n volwaardige Christenskool in ‘n bestaande skoolgebou op die plaas Middelbult van Mnr Josua du Plessis by Delmas. Die Hoof is Me Lizette van Onselen. Die doelwitte en visie van Nesher Privaatskool word hieronder uiteengesit.

Me.  Sarlien Prinsloo en   Daleen Schwartz ,  haar man, Chris,  en Christelle,  ma van Jeandre, een van die leerders, met 12 van hulle leerlinge het Treeferns op 12- 14 Oktober 2011 besoek vir ‘n Leierskampkursus. Behalwe stiltetye en lesings oor verskeie onderwerpe het hulle speletjies gespeel, sokker teen die plaaslike Thembalethu Primary School gespeel, vlieghengel geoefen, gestap en lekker ge-eet. Hospitality

Hospitality is all about the relationship between host and guest whether he or she be family, friend or visitor. The word “hospitality” is derived from the Latin “hospes”,  and  “hospice” as we know it means home, guest house, hospital. There is no limit to hospitality, it is showing respect for one’s guests, and caring for them like family. Genuine hospitality is providing in the needs of your guests no matter what it costs, eg. washing baby’s nappies, replacing a flat tyre, jump start a stubborn engine, pulling a vehicle out of the mud, making a fire, catching a fish, gutting, and even cooking it. It also comprises service, quality, and affordability. It costs nothing to be polite and friendly, and it is the best investment one will ever make.

In the business of fly fishing and trout fishing hospitality is particularly appreciated by the fly fisher as he or she is people oriented concerned about people and their environment, the caring type.

Some countries practice a code of hospitality, just like we South Africans take pride in our south-african hospitality.

We at Treeferns Trout Lodge are not claiming that we comply in all respects, but we strongly believe in the ethics of hospitality, and we try our best to make our guests feel at home in the spirit of giving is better than  receiving.
